Co-op Divisions and Member Authorities

Current Co-op divisions overview 1. Co-op divisions separate members and information into different categories. 2. Current Co-op divisions include: (a) Member Information i. Standard member information. (b) Co-op Local i. Local information about the MWI co-op ii. This is also a status that is assigned by members to other members that are believed to be members who A. Believe in creating a low cost local information cooperative B. will help with quality control in MWI in order to keep the site clean, accurate, and conservative in terms of the quality of information that is posted. (c) Co-op All Members i. Information and resources for the members of the co-op. (d) Local Insight i. Members with this status will post News and Opinions on topics of local information. ii. These members will be picked by other members of the Cooperative who have Division Authority. A. Members with Local Insight status are meant to be members who have inside knowledge of local issues on an ongoing basis or an issue of the moment. B. These members will also be held to a higher standard of conduct in how they present their information and opinions as compared to information posted in the Member Information division. (e) National Analysis i. Members with this status will post News and Opinions on topics of National interest. ii. The process for picking these members is the same as in Local Insight. Current Co-op divisions 1. Member Information This is the standard division. All members have this authority. This is the default setting when creating a Standard Ad. 2. Co-op Local This optional status will be given to members who agree to help with the Quality Control (QC) tasks for the cooperative. (a) QC consists of: i. Approving of new Minor Descriptions for general usage by all members in all locations. ii. Approving new Premium Ads or changes in existing Premium Ads.

iii. Voting on Ads that have been tagged as having Inappropriate Content. The member will be able to give an opinion and vote on whether an Ad is OK or should be shut down. (b) Members will be held accountable for their QC actions. i. Members will not be allowed to be anonymous in their actions. (c) The information that can be posted in Co-op local is i. Local self help Resources for Co-op members ii. Members that provide discounts for other co-op members will also be listed here. A. We will eventually have a membership option of a plastic co-op member card. 3. Local Insight This optional status will be given to members of the community who have inside knowledge on a subject. (a) Some people will be given Local Insight status because they have inside knowledge: i. on a continual basis. ii. Or on a current topic of local interest. (b) Members with Local Insight status are allowed to create local Minor Descriptions (topics) that are subjects of local interest. (c) Examples of people who would be given Local Insight status are: i. Politicians at the Local and State level. ii. People within the community who have knowledge and expertise in a certain area that they want to share. 4. Co-op All Members This optional status will be given to members of the community who will provide self help information on Internet based resources that provide tools for Co-op members to create and improve information in their accounts. 5. National Analysis This optional status will be given to members who have inside knowledge and expertise on matters that are National issues. (a) Members with National Analysis status are allowed to create Minor Descriptions (topics) that are on subjects of National interest. Administrative Authorities overview 1. Administrative authorities include: Manage, Admin, and Division 2. Administrative authorities are arranged in a hierarchy. Administrative Authorities 1. Manage Authority (a) Manage authority can assign all administrative authorities below it and the 4 optional divisions. i. This includes: Admin, Division, Co-op Local, Local Insight, Co-op All Members, and National Analysis. (b) Manage authority will allow access to all administrative functions.

i. Administrative functions are behind the scenes processes that allow for A. Manual control of entries in data tables. B. Access to the creation and modification of Help, FAQ, and Rules. C. Access to rules for quality control. (c) Manage authority will assign Admin authority. i. A task for Manage authority is to assign Admin authority to other members. A. The question for members on this committee is Who do you think will make good decisions in assigning Division authority to other members? (d) Other tasks will be assigned to Manage authority as the situation evolves. 2. Admin Authority (a) Admin authority can assign all administrative authorities below it and the 4 optional divisions. i. This includes: Division, Co-op Local, Local Insight, Co-op All Members, and National Analysis. (b) The main purpose of Admin authority is to assign Division authority to other members. i. The process of deciding who gets Admin authority is probably decided by a committee of other members. A. The question for members on this committee is: Who do you think will make good decisions in assigning the 4 optional Co-op divisions to other members? (c) A task that will be assigned in the near future is the naming of: i. Districts or Wards within a City. ii. Neighborhoods within a District or Ward. iii. Areas within a State. iv. The process of deciding these areas is probably decided by a committee of other members. (d) Other tasks will be assigned to Admin authority as the situation evolves. 3. Division Authority (a) Division authority can assign the 4 optional divisions to other members. i. This includes: Co-op Local, Local Insight, Co-op All Members, and National Analysis. ii. The question for members with Admin authority is: Who do you think would be qualified in meeting the requirements of the different co-op divisions? A. Co-op Local Who do you think would be ethical and fair in providing quality control? B. Local Insight Who do you think would provide quality information on subjects that are important to the local community? C. Co-op All Members Who do you think would provide quality information on

resources to help co-op members create quality information? D. National Analysis - Who do you think would provide quality information on subjects that are important to the whole Nation? (b) Division authority will be assigned to a large number of people. (c) Other tasks will be assigned to Division authority as the situation evolves. Future Co-op Divisions 1. MWI will also have the Future divisions of: (a) National Manufacturing i. This division will be for members who create or manufacture products that can be used in other states or countries. A. Ads in this division will not be allowed for members who only produce something locally such as a restaurant. ii. One General or Weblog ad per account will be allowed in this division. (b) National Service i. This division will be for members who services that can be used in other states. A. For example, A member who does technical writing as a service. ii. One General or Weblog ad per member will be allowed in this division. (c) National Resume i. This division will be for members who want to post a resume and are willing to relocate to another City or State. ii. One General or Weblog ad per member will be allowed in this division. (d) Education Local i. This division will be used by members of the cooperative who have knowledge that they wish to share in areas of local interest. A. This could be a default status given to all members. B. This status could be taken away if the privilege is abused by posting blatantly selfpromoting information. C. This division will have self help resources. The majority of the information will probably be: Self Help Videos that are attached to General Ad Spaces (Document Spaces). Self Help Information in Weblogs.

D. Members that use MWI for commercial use (paid Ad Spaces) have an incentive to post this type of information to show that they are community minded. Many people who view these ads will want to do business with these members. They will tend to

appreciate that they are community minded. E. Supporting local education will have a positive influence on people within the community who will become members of MWI just because they like the thought of supporting public education. F. The Proceeds from Premium Ad Spaces in this division will be used to fund educational resources at Public Libraries. This includes computers and educational resources that are accessible from those computers.

(e) Education All members i. This division will be used by members of the cooperative who have knowledge that they wish to share. A. The information is this division is not dependent on location. For example, how to use picnik photo editing software. B. This status could be taken away if the privilege is abused by posting blatantly selfpromoting information. C. This division will have self help resources. The majority of the information will probably be: Self Help Videos that are attached to General Ad Spaces (Document Spaces). Self Help Information in Weblogs.

D. Members that use MWI for commercial use (paid Ad Spaces) have an incentive to post this type of information to show that they are community minded. Many people who view these ads will want to do business with these members. They will tend to appreciate that they are community minded. E. Supporting public education will have a positive influence on people within a community who will become members of MWI just because they like the thought of supporting public education. F. The Proceeds from Premium Ad Spaces in this division will be used to fund educational resources at Public Libraries. G. This includes computers and educational resources that are accessible from those computers. (f) Daily Deal i. This will be restricted to On-Sale information and only allow a range of ad dates of 1 day. ii. The posted deal will be for the next day or the current day. iii. In the future Premium Ads in this division will be restricted to 1 day long. iv. The ability to send out a text or email message to members who have chosen to follow the merchant will also be added to this division. v. The use of Proceeds from Premium Ad Spaces in this division will be determined by the first elected Board of Directors.

(g) Donate Local i. Local Charities and other Non profit organizations that are requesting funding be allowed to post information here. ii. Organizations that are in the business of soliciting for donations for charitable causes will not be allowed to post information here. (h) Donate National i. Non profit organizations that are fulfilling a need that benefits everyone and are requesting funding be allowed to post information here. A. An example of this is medical research. ii. Organizations that are in the business of soliciting for donations for charitable causes will not be allowed to post information here.
